Scheduler/Authorization Coordinator
Summary: responsible for the coordination of the authorization/scheduling process, including but not limited to submitting clinical documentation, tracking approvals, initiating appeals for denials, and scheduling appointments.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Submit, review, and process pre-authorization requests via insurance portals or phone.
- Collect and send necessary clinical documentation and medical necessity notes.
- Monitor the status of submitted requests and managing denials, including filling appeals.
- Acquire and verify insurance benefits and precertification as required by insurance.
- Obtain and review physician orders for scheduling of outpatient testing.
- Schedule required outpatient testing and procedures for Surgery, Cardiology, and other Outpatient procedures.
- Acquire medical necessity for all Medicare patients and perform net compliance for Medicare patients to adhere to Medicare guidelines.
- Prepare up-front collection documentation and enter patient information into scheduling and registration system, including pre-registration, and insurance authorization documentation.
- Other duties as assigned.
